          no, they are adding moon Birds to Cathay so expect them as character mount option when Cathay is added to TOW
          lore from GW
          >Favoured of the Empress, the Great Moon Birds are found in the highest peaks of the Mountains of Heaven. They are said to make their nests in the craters of Mannslieb, the silver moon of the Warhammer World, and only fly down to earth when called by either the Empress or the most powerful Astromancers. Fearsome to behold in battle, the Moon Bird are often wreathed in silvery flames – or moon fire – which burns the enemies of the empire who come into contact with it. Powerful lords, especially wizards of the Celestial Court, might even be granted a Moon Bird as a mount, though this is usually only for a short time before the creature once more returns to the heavens.

        Anonymous

        I see the answer only in an unrelated question, but the intentions are pretty unambiguous here in my opinion, so fbig should still count as ongoing combat

        Combat
        Q: If my unit loses a round of combat and either Gives
        Ground or Falls Back in Good Order, can it choose to use
        different weapons in the next turn if the enemy made a follow
        up or pursuit move?
        A: No. Even though the units separated momentarily, they remain
        locked in place and engaged in combat once the follow up or pursuit
        move has been made. In other words, the combat is ongoing and
        neither unit has the time to stow one weapon in exchange for
        another (the exception being the time it takes to discard a broken
        lance or spear and draw a sword).
